Transaction 03eec58b5f863718cf4bbb9b31726d588f857866fae89f9b9686680946324cb7
1 Input
1 Output
-
03eec58b5f863718cf4bbb9b31726d588f857866fae89f9b9686680946324cb7:0
- value
- 1320578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d17901d5761cd1648deb484d12ca509905027f10 OP_EQUAL
- address
- 3Lnc7Mv5ZkTCF1z5zwf3weD92U3n2FMvmh